Postmortem timeline — Keldra KV incident. 14:02: false-positive rate on the bloom filter fronting the Keldra store spiked after the resize job ran with stale cardinality estimates. 14:09: cache misses flooded the backing nodes; p99 tripled. 14:21: filter rebuilt with corrected parameters, traffic normalized by 14:30. Fix shipped in the hotfix branch; rollback not required. The offending build is identified by the token below.

session token of yajof-bagef = htk4_937d

## Ownership

Hey support folks — this is KeyTumbler, our internal secrets-rotation utility. It rotates service credentials on a rolling schedule, so most "my token stopped working" tickets trace back here. Before escalating, check the rotation log viewer first; nine times out of ten it explains the breakage. Feature requests go in the backlog board, not tickets. If you genuinely need a human, there is exactly one owner, and their name follows.

named custodian: Belius Casath Ulaix Sorius

## Runbook — Bucketeer Assignment Service Release

Review checklist before approving the release PR: assignment hashing unchanged unless the migration flag is set; experiment config schema version bumped if bucket logic changed; canary ran for 2h with parity metrics within 0.5%. Tag only from the release branch. The CI signer stamps the artifact at tag time; reviewers confirm the stamp matches the active key. Verification should be done against the current release signing key:

rollout seal: bky4_DFM9

Migration step 4: Bramwick scanner integration. Stop the legacy Corvess listener before flipping traffic. The new decoder on Tarnhold accepts the same wedge protocol but rejects unpadded payloads, so flush the buffer first. Verify the health endpoint returns ready, then restart the aggregator once. Do not re-enable the old firmware path. Apply the configuration values shown below exactly as written.

service settings:
[quenath]
host = quenath.zemvarcorp.corp
user = quenath_svc
database = quenath_prod